Fukuoka man held after 5 robberies committed in one hour

12 Comments

A 34-year-old man was arrested for robbery in the city of Yukuhashi, Fukuoka Prefecture, on Sunday, police said Monday, adding that they are looking into a possible connection between that crime and a spate of other violent robberies in the area shortly after.

Police identified the suspect as Hideo Nakano, who works as a truck driver. They said that he allegedly approached a 27-year-old female restaurant employee as she was walking home around 1:50 a.m. Sunday, grabbed her by the arm and threatened her with a knife. He demanded cash and made off with about 45,000 yen.

Over the next hour, five other robberies were reported. Police said that in all the cases, an adult male brandished a knife and robbed four male taxi drivers and a female restaurant employee.

Police picked up Nakano because he was seen driving a black car that matched a description of the getaway vehicle.
